Subject: [PATCH] checkpatch: do not apply "initialise globals to 0" check to BPF progs

BPF programs explicitly initialise global variables to 0 to make sure
clang (v10 or older) do not put the variables in the common section.
Skip "initialise globals to 0" check for BPF programs to elimiate error
messages like:

ERROR: do not initialise globals to 0
#19: FILE: samples/bpf/tracex1_kern.c:21:

Another possible option is simply to add --ignore=GLOBAL_INITIALISERS
to the checkpatch command line for these files.

Good point! I will make this a function in v2.

--ignore is not ideal, because it is common for a BPF test/sample patch
to have both BPF code and user space code. Adding --ignore will skip the
check for user space code.
